AI Chatbot Comparison for UK SMEs
Rank | Tool | Best For | Starting Price (UK) | Our Rating |
---|---|---|---|---|
#1 | Intercom | All-in-one customer engagement | From ~$29/seat/month (£22.91/seat/month, billed annually) | ★★★★★ |
#2 | Tidio | Micro & Small Businesses | Free plan available; Paid from ~$29/month (£22.91/month, billed annually) | ★★★★☆ |
#3 | Zendesk | Integrated customer service desks | From £45/agent/month (Suite Team, billed annually) | ★★★★☆ |
#4 | Drift | B2B lead generation & sales | From ~$2,500/month (£1,975/month, billed annually) | ★★★★☆ |
#5 | HubSpot Chatbot Builder | Businesses using HubSpot CRM | Free plan available; Paid from £18/month (Starter) | ★★★★☆ |
LiveChat | Integrated live chat & bot | From £19.95/month (billed annually) | ★★★★☆ | |
#7 | Freshchat | Omnichannel messaging | Free plan available; Paid from £12/user/month (billed annually) | ★★★★☆ |
#8 | Ada | Enterprise-level automation | Custom (Enterprise), typically from ~$5,000/month (£3,950/month) | ★★★★☆ |
#9 | Crisp | Startups & all-in-one value | Free plan available; Paid from ~$95/month (£75.05/month) | ★★★☆☆ |
#10 | Chatbot.com | Dedicated bot platform | From ~$52/month (£41.08/month, billed annually) | ★★★★☆ |
1. Intercom

Intercom is a premium, all-in-one customer communications platform. Its AI chatbot, Fin, is one of the most advanced on the market, capable of holding natural conversations and resolving complex queries by drawing directly from your help documentation. It's an excellent choice for UK SMEs looking to provide a top-tier, automated support experience.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Powerful and accurate AI (Fin) reduces support load.
- Excellent integration with a full customer service suite.
- Strong data privacy and GDPR compliance features.
- Highly customisable to match brand voice.
Cons:
- Higher price point compared to competitors.
- Can be complex to set up for very small teams.
2. Tidio

Tidio is a fantastic entry point for UK SMEs venturing into AI chatbots. It combines live chat, chatbots, and email marketing in one simple interface. Its visual chatbot builder is incredibly intuitive, allowing businesses to create automated workflows without any coding knowledge. The generous free plan makes it a risk-free option to get started.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Very easy-to-use visual chatbot builder.
- Excellent value with a strong free forever plan.
- Combines live chat and chatbots seamlessly.
- Good for both customer service and lead generation.
Cons:
- AI capabilities are less advanced than premium rivals.
- Can become pricey as you add more features/operators.
3. Zendesk

For UK SMEs already using or considering a comprehensive helpdesk solution, Zendesk's AI chatbots are a natural fit. They integrate perfectly into the Zendesk Suite, allowing for a seamless handover from bot to human agent. The AI is trained on billions of real customer service interactions, making it highly effective at understanding user intent and providing accurate answers.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Unbeatable integration with the Zendesk ecosystem.
- Powerful, industry-leading AI for support automation.
- Excellent for creating a unified omnichannel support experience.
- Strong analytics and reporting features.
Cons:
- Best value when committed to the full Zendesk Suite.
- Can be more expensive than standalone chatbot solutions.
4. Drift

Drift is a leader in conversational marketing and sales, focusing on B2B lead generation. Its AI chatbots are designed to engage website visitors, qualify them in real-time, and schedule meetings for sales teams. It's a premium choice for UK businesses where the website is a primary sales channel.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Excellent for B2B sales and marketing automation.
- Powerful playbooks for targeted engagement.
- Seamlessly integrates with sales calendars.
- Identifies anonymous website visitors (Drift Intel).
Cons:
- Can be very expensive, especially for SMEs.
- Primarily focused on sales, less on general support.
5. HubSpot Chatbot Builder

Part of the HubSpot ecosystem, the Chatbot Builder allows businesses to create chatbots that integrate seamlessly with their CRM. It's excellent for lead qualification, booking meetings, and providing support, all while keeping the HubSpot contact database updated. It's a strong contender for any SME already using HubSpot.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Deep integration with HubSpot CRM and Marketing Hub.
- Free and easy-to-use builder to get started.
- Good for lead nurturing and data collection.
- Part of a complete business growth platform.
Cons:
- Advanced AI features are limited compared to dedicated platforms.
- Most powerful when used within the full HubSpot suite.
6. LiveChat

LiveChat is a comprehensive customer service platform that has expanded to include a powerful ChatBot feature. It allows businesses to automate conversations using a visual builder, handling common queries and routing complex issues to human agents. It's known for its user-friendly interface and robust feature set.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Very easy to use visual builder.
- Strong integration with the LiveChat helpdesk suite.
- Good balance of features for the price.
- Excellent reporting and analytics.
Cons:
- The chatbot is an add-on to the core LiveChat product.
- AI is more rules-based than some advanced competitors.
7. Freshchat

Freshchat is Freshworks' modern messaging and chatbot solution. It's designed for both sales and support, using AI-powered bots to engage users across web, mobile, and social messengers. It integrates tightly with the broader Freshworks CRM and helpdesk ecosystem, making it a great choice for existing users.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Excellent omnichannel support (WhatsApp, Messenger, etc.).
- Good integration with the Freshworks suite.
- AI features for intent detection and routing.
- Generous free plan for small teams.
Cons:
- Can be complex to configure all features.
- Pricing can escalate with more advanced needs.
8. Ada

Ada is an enterprise-grade, AI-native customer service automation platform. It focuses heavily on using AI to resolve the majority of customer inquiries without human intervention. It's a powerful, scalable solution for medium to larger UK businesses looking to significantly reduce support costs and improve efficiency.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Extremely powerful and accurate AI.
- Designed for high-volume automation.
- Strong analytics and reporting.
- Focus on personalised customer journeys.
Cons:
- High-end pricing, not typically for very small businesses.
- Requires significant setup and training investment.
9. Crisp

Crisp offers an all-in-one customer messaging platform that includes a shared inbox, CRM, and a chatbot builder. It's a popular choice among startups and SMEs for its simple pricing and wide range of features. The chatbot allows for creating automated scenarios to help with support and sales.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Affordable, all-in-one pricing model.
- Includes CRM and knowledge base features.
- Simple and clean user interface.
- Good for startups and small teams.
Cons:
- Chatbot builder is less advanced than specialised tools.
- AI capabilities are basic compared to leaders.
10. Chatbot.com

A product from the makers of LiveChat, Chatbot.com is a dedicated platform for building and deploying AI chatbots for any purpose. It features a visual builder, pre-built templates, and integrations with many services. It's designed to work as a standalone solution or in tandem with LiveChat.
Pros for UK SMEs:
- Powerful and flexible visual workflow builder.
- Good selection of templates to start quickly.
- Integrates with many platforms, including LiveChat.
- Strong analytics on bot performance.
Cons:
- Can have a steeper learning curve than simpler tools.
- Pricing is separate from LiveChat.
